Down by the River Posted December 26, 2019 Share Posted December 26, 2019 6 minutes ago, Rush17 said: I love it when teams take guys that are young for their draft year... as opposed to arguments in years past that you take the older guy because they are further along in development. IMO the guy nearly a year older than the kid born in September will be putting up better stats simply because they are further along in physical/maturational development. If you've got a coin flip, take the younger kid. 4 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
